Liberty RV Park Introduce
If you are searching for "RV parks near me" in the Dayton, Texas area, Liberty RV Park, located at 1567 Co Rd 486, presents itself as a potentially convenient option for RV travelers. Situated in Dayton, TX, this park aims to provide a base for those exploring the region or needing temporary or long-term accommodation for their recreational vehicles. To provide a comprehensive overview, it's essential to consider both the positive and negative feedback available from individuals who have stayed at the park.
One reviewer described Liberty RV Park as "convient, quiet, well maintained" and considered it "one of the better parks I’ve stayed in." This positive feedback suggests that for some, the park offers a satisfactory experience, particularly in terms of location, peacefulness, and upkeep. A quiet environment can be a significant draw for RVers seeking respite during their travels or a tranquil long-term living situation. The mention of being "well maintained" implies that the park management may strive to keep the grounds and facilities in good order, contributing to a more pleasant stay for guests.
However, it is crucial to consider other feedback that presents a contrasting perspective. One lengthy review raises several significant concerns regarding the park's amenities, management practices, and overall value. This reviewer states that promised facilities such as a "wash house and red room" have "NEVER BEEN FINISHED" and that a "dog park…as advertised" does not exist. The lack of promised amenities can be a major disappointment for guests who rely on these facilities for their comfort and convenience. For pet owners, the absence of a dog park, especially if advertised, can be particularly problematic.
The same reviewer also alleges inconsistencies in pricing, claiming that "they charged the people who are long time residents more than new incoming." Such practices can lead to dissatisfaction and a feeling of unfair treatment among long-term residents who have contributed to the community over time. Transparency and fairness in pricing are essential for fostering a positive relationship between park management and residents.
Communication appears to be another area of concern, with the reviewer stating that the management does "not reliably inform people about mail and park problems." Effective communication is vital for ensuring that residents are aware of important information that may affect their stay or daily lives. Issues with mail delivery and a lack of updates on park-related problems can lead to frustration and inconvenience.
Furthermore, the review describes difficulties with mail access, alleging that management gives people "trouble with checking the only post box for their own mail." Access to mail is a fundamental need for residents, and any restrictions or issues in this regard can be a significant inconvenience and source of stress.
Concerns about maintenance and security are also raised. The reviewer mentions a "man who claims to be maintenance and security" who allegedly "does the bare minimum and drinks all day." This is a serious accusation that, if true, would indicate a significant lapse in the park's upkeep and security measures. The reviewer further claims that "there is noth Done at night when the speeders and people doing drugs are most active because they know that they will get away with it," suggesting a potential lack of effective security during critical times.
The reviewer also recounts a personal experience involving an alleged wrongful eviction following a complaint about a dangerous situation involving the manager's dog. This account includes allegations of harassment and bullying and claims that the eviction was carried out "without the proper process and paperwork." Such allegations are extremely serious and paint a concerning picture of the park's management and treatment of residents. The reviewer concludes by advising against staying at the park, even briefly, and notes that promised work from four years prior remains unfinished, suggesting a pattern of unfulfilled commitments.

The place started out a quiet place but the wash house and red room has NEVER BEEN FINISHED AND there is no dog park…as advertised.l they charged the people who are long time residents more than new incoming… they do not reliably inform people about mail and park problems… they give people trouble with checking the only post box for their own mail… they give people man who claims to be maintenance and security does the bare minimum and drinks all day and there is noth Done at night when the speeders and people doing drugs are most active because they know that they will get away with it… the manager is in a wheelchair and has an aggressive dog that is never on a leash when it clearly states ballpark rules that all dogs kept his dog, jumped up and looked at my husband‘s throat and after we complain to the odor, we were wrongfully evicted for reporting a dangerous situation, without the proper process and paperwork we were harassed and bullied. They are not very honest and I would not advise anyone to stay there briefly. I Upon looking at other Reviews that were posted four years ago. The work that they promised was done is ongoing and will never be finished. My husband and I stayed there for almost 2 years. And nothing that was promised was kept their Wi-Fi is shoddy at best and the park is not worth the price.
Jan 13, 2025 · Pamela BurnsConvient, quiet, well maintained. One of the better parks I’ve stayed in, and I travel for work
Jan 26, 2025 · Robert AndrewsThe park it's self is orderly, quiet, well maintained. Seems to be fairly new. Decent sized lot with grass. Easy to pull in, and exit. They're working on having bath house and laundry area. The personnel on-site is cool but...and i gotta say that I was really enjoying some much needed "away" time, feeling comfortable with my overall surroundings. Nice place.
Mar 31, 2022 · Christy BitelyOur first week being here has been very quiet & enjoyable! The owners and other Families 👪 here are very pleasant and cordial! I'm very very pleased with the professionalism shown to all customers as well as the "come on over, make you feel at home" Southern hospitality warm attitude!!! This is the way a true professional business should treat their customers/or clients. Thank you!
Feb 11, 2022 · Shannon MarieI stayed there for a few months in 2016. Good people, excellently kept. Enjoyed the neighbors and it was quiet at night.
